What Makes Upcoming Fintech Conferences Essential

Fintech conferences serve as crucial gathering points for industry leaders, startups, and technology providers. These events showcase cutting-edge solutions including artificial intelligence in banking, regulatory technology advances, and cryptocurrency developments. Attendees gain insights into market trends, regulatory changes, and emerging business models that shape the financial services landscape.

Major conferences typically feature keynote presentations from industry pioneers, panel discussions on regulatory compliance, and demonstrations of breakthrough technologies. Participants explore topics ranging from open banking initiatives to cybersecurity frameworks, providing comprehensive coverage of the fintech ecosystem.

Key Technologies Shaping Financial Services

Emerging technologies continue to revolutionize financial services delivery and operations. Artificial intelligence enables personalized financial advice, fraud detection, and automated customer service. Blockchain technology facilitates secure transactions, smart contracts, and decentralized finance applications.

Machine learning algorithms improve credit scoring, risk assessment, and investment strategies. Cloud computing provides scalable infrastructure for financial institutions, while application programming interfaces enable seamless integration between different financial services platforms.
